The 5 Biggest Nike Stores in the United States

Biggest Stores Cover

Nike, the world’s leading sportswear brand, boasts an impressive collection of retail stores across the United States. These stores offer a wide range of athletic footwear, apparel, and accessories for customers seeking high-performance gear. Among these, five Nike stores stand out as the largest, providing an unparalleled shopping experience for sports enthusiasts and fashion-forward consumers alike. Let’s delve into the details of each of these colossal Nike stores:

  • Nike New York – 5th Avenue: Located in the heart of Manhattan’s bustling Midtown district, the Nike New York store on 5th Avenue reigns supreme as the largest Nike store in the country. Spanning a massive 68,000 square feet across four levels, this flagship store is a shopper’s paradise, showcasing the latest footwear releases, apparel collections, and innovative technologies.

  • Nike Chicago – Michigan Avenue: Nestled along Chicago’s iconic Magnificent Mile, the Nike Chicago store on Michigan Avenue is a sprawling retail spectacle. Covering an area of 65,000 square feet, this two-story store offers an extensive selection of athletic footwear, apparel, and sports equipment. With dedicated sections for basketball, running, training, and sportswear, Nike Chicago caters to athletes of all levels and disciplines.

  • Nike San Francisco – Union Square: Situated in San Francisco’s vibrant Union Square neighborhood, the Nike San Francisco store is a haven for sports enthusiasts and fashionistas alike. Occupying a spacious 46,000 square feet, this two-level store features an impressive assortment of footwear, apparel, and accessories, along with interactive experiences and a dedicated customization zone, making it a popular destination for sneakerheads and sportswear enthusiasts.

  • Nike Los Angeles – The Grove: Amidst the bustling outdoor shopping complex of The Grove in Los Angeles, the Nike Los Angeles store commands attention with its expansive 40,000-square-foot space. Spread across two levels, this store caters to the city’s vibrant and active lifestyle, offering a diverse range of footwear, apparel, and sports gear. The store’s vibrant atmosphere, complete with interactive displays and personalized shopping services, makes it a must-visit destination for sports enthusiasts and fashion-conscious consumers.

  • Nike Boston – Newbury Street: In the heart of Boston’s historic Back Bay neighborhood, the Nike Boston store on Newbury Street is a haven for sports enthusiasts and fashion-forward individuals. With a spacious 35,000 square feet of retail space, this two-level store boasts a comprehensive collection of footwear, apparel, and accessories, catering to athletes and fitness enthusiasts of all levels. The store’s modern design and interactive displays provide a captivating shopping experience for visitors exploring the latest Nike innovations.

Nike, Inc. (stylized as NIKE) is an American athletic footwear and apparel corporation headquartered near Beaverton, Oregon, United States. It is the world's largest supplier of athletic shoes and apparel and a major manufacturer of sports equipment, with revenue in excess of US$46 billion in its fiscal year 2022.The company was founded on January 25, 1964, as "Blue Ribbon Sports", by Bill Bowerman and Phil Knight, and officially became Nike, Inc. on May 30, 1971. The company takes its name from Nike, the Greek goddess of victory. Nike markets its products under its own brand, as well as Nike Golf, Nike Pro, Nike+, Nike Blazers, Air Force 1, Nike Dunk, Air Max, Foamposite, Nike Skateboarding, Nike CR7, and subsidiaries including Air Jordan and Converse (brand). Nike also owned Bauer Hockey from 1995 to 2008, and previously owned Cole Haan, Umbro, and Hurley International. In addition to manufacturing sportswear and equipment, the company operates retail stores under the Niketown name. Nike sponsors many high-profile athletes and sports teams around the world, with the highly recognized trademarks of "Just Do It" and the Swoosh logo.
As of 2020, it employed 76,700 people worldwide. In 2020, the brand alone was valued in excess of $32 billion, making it the most valuable brand among sports businesses. Previously, in 2017, the Nike brand was valued at $29.6 billion. Nike ranked 89th in the 2018 Fortune 500 list of the largest United States corporations by total revenue.

While Nike is undeniably a powerhouse in the athletic footwear and apparel industry, there are several popular alternatives that provide high-quality products and cater to different consumer preferences. Here are three of the top Nike alternatives that are highly regarded in the United States:

  • Adidas: Adidas is a German multinational corporation that is renowned for its sportswear and athletic shoes. It offers a wide range of products for various sports, including soccer, basketball, running, and more. Adidas focuses on combining performance, style, and comfort in its designs. The brand has collaborations with celebrities and designers, which adds an element of fashion-forwardness to its products. Adidas is known for its innovative technologies such as Boost cushioning and Primeknit materials, which provide enhanced comfort and performance.
  • Under Armour: Under Armour is an American company that specializes in performance apparel, footwear, and accessories. It has gained popularity for its compression gear and athletic clothing that is designed to optimize performance and aid in muscle recovery. Under Armour’s shoes are known for their durability and stability, making them a favorite among athletes. The brand is recognized for its use of moisture-wicking fabrics and technologies that keep the wearer cool and dry during intense workouts. Under Armour also offers a wide range of products for different sports, including training, running, and basketball.
  • New Balance: New Balance is an American company that excels in producing athletic shoes and lifestyle footwear. It is known for its commitment to craftsmanship, quality materials, and comfortable fit. New Balance offers a diverse range of shoe models, catering to different needs and preferences. The brand is particularly popular among runners for its running shoes that provide excellent cushioning, stability, and support. New Balance prides itself on manufacturing a significant portion of its shoes in the United States, appealing to consumers who value locally-made products.

These Nike alternatives have earned a strong reputation in the United States, thanks to their dedication to quality, performance, and style. Whether you’re seeking innovation, compression gear, or well-crafted footwear, Adidas, Under Armour, and New Balance are excellent options to consider.
